Criteria for Awards:

                    1. Only members of S1. David's congregation will be eligible.

                   2. Each applicant must formally apply to the Scholarship Committee, using this
                       form. Deadline is May 20, 2012.

                   3 Each applicant will be judged by his/her contributions to the life of the parish
                      (acolyte, church school, lay reader, choir, youth group, assistance in grounds
                      maintenance under supervision, community service, etc.). Character and
                      academic performance will also be taken into consideration.

                     4 Financial aid awards are given to assist with tuition for study programs such as
                       college, graduate study, career enhancement and special summer programs.

--The Scholarship Committee

The funds for scholarship awards have been made available from generous bequests
by Caroline Walker, Edith Hutton, Grace Wheat, Ruth Stott and the Rev. Charles
Ehly, as well as from contributions by the S1. David's Thrift Shop, memorial
donations and donations by individual members and non-members of S1. David's parish.

The management of the fund will be under the direct supervision of the Scholarship
Committee.
